BlockBeats News, January 14 — According to The New York Times, Federal Reserve Kashkari stated that the actions taken by the Trump administration against the Federal Reserve over the past year “are actually a monetary policy issue.” Previously, the Department of Justice led a criminal investigation into Federal Reserve Chair Powell. Kashkari said in an interview, “The escalation of the situation over the past year is actually a monetary policy issue. I think the Chairman explained it very accurately.” Kashkari also said, “This moment is an opportunity to ‘explain to our voters and the American people why the independence of the Federal Reserve is so important to the health and vitality of the U.S. economy.’”
Kashkari also stated, “I don’t think there’s a need to cut interest rates in January,” but added that there might be some room for cuts later this year, though he said it is “still too early” to tell.
